Ministry of State for Environmental Affairs in cooperation with the Korean Business Center organized Saturday a music celebration and a campaign to plant 300 trees of peace and love in Tishreen Park in Damascus.
The activity coincided with the Prophet Mohammad’s birthday and Christmas Day and it included a distribution of gifts for the most beautiful decoration attached to the trees planted in the park.
It comes within the framework of the ‘My Tree Project” that aims to create volunteer culture among the young generation to enhance patriotism, State Minister for Environmental Affairs said.
NaziraSarkis told reporters that Young people’s participation in the tree planting campaign proves their civilized role in the process of rebuilding the homeland, adding that responsiveness of volunteers to plant tree is positive indication to expand the voluntary works in the field of environment.
On his part, Korean Business Center’s Director ZahirZenbarakji clarified that the ‘ My tree Project’ is based on the idea that every Syrian citizen plants a tree and attach his/her name on it and to care for it.
“Our goal is to plant 23.000.000 trees with the participation of Syrian young people,” he said.
The project comes with the framework of a Memorandum of Understanding signed by Ministry of State for Environmental Affairs and the Korean Business Center in 2012.
